Unhappy Curb Accident

Was driving in a parking lot and swerved to avoid being sideswiped. Front wheel went over the curb and came smashing down on side skirt and rear rim/tire. Car is less than a month old. Safe to say I was not the happiest after.















Thoughts on repairs?

Sorry this happened. I feel your pain. I got a crack in my windshield on Friday from a rock-strike while driving on the highway.

The damage to your wheel looks repairable. I've seen skilled wheel repair shops do a great job fixing damage worse than it looks like you have. As long as the wheel isn't bent, you should be fine. I hit a curb once in an ice storm and although the damage to the wheel didn't look too severe, the wheel was bent in such a way that it wasn't repairable.

I would probably replace the tire. It may very well have internal damage that may cause it to develop a sidewall bubble or fail while on the road.

It's difficult to tell how badly your side-skirt is damaged but I'm sure a body shop can fix it without too much difficulty.

Sorry about your damage @speedracer33. I have 2 rims (same rims as yours) with varying degrees of curb rash / scrapes / damage, and my local dealer quoted me $167.00 plus tax per rim for cosmetic repair.

I second the tire replacement (my local dealer charges $245 + tax to mount & balance one brand new tire). If you opt to have the dealer do any work, check their site for coupons. I sometimes wait until a coupon becomes available before having any non-essential service done. You'll probably find a cheaper tire at a chain store, but probably not the same exact tire as the other 3.

Personally, for the skirt damage I'd go to a reputable body shop and not use MB. It's in a place where even if they only did a "pretty good" job it's not going to be noticeable.

Thanks for the reply @ATLbenz13. Im sorry to hear about your rims/tire. I actually just picked up the vehicle from MB deanship today. The dealer repaired the damaged rim for $255 CAD including tax. A pretty penny for such a minor repair but I felt awful seeing the scratched AMG logo every day.

Additionally they wanted my to purchase new tires but I contacted a few places and they said it would not be an issue. MB simply turned the tire so the "damage" is on the inside. I have attached some photos to show the rim repair. I am going to purchase some painting polish that will match the side skirt.
